如何判断服务器上我使用的是gpu还是cpu
时间: 2023-05-25 14:03:21 浏览: 1370
您可以使用以下命令来检查服务器上是否安装了GPU:
1. 如果您使用Linux系统,请在终端中输入以下命令:
```
lspci | grep -i nvidia
```
如果该命令输出了NVIDIA的显卡相关信息,则表示您的服务器上有GPU可用。
2. 另外,您也可以使用以下命令来检查GPU的驱动是否正确安装:
```
nvidia-smi
```
如果该命令可以正常输出GPU相关信息,则表示您的服务器上有GPU可用,且驱动已经正确安装。如果该命令不能正常输出,则表示您的服务器上可能没有GPU可用,或者GPU驱动没有正确安装。
如果您使用Windows系统,则可以通过打开设备管理器来查看是否有NVIDIA GPU设备存在。如果有,那么您的服务器上就有GPU可用。
如果以上命令都不能确定您使用的是GPU还是CPU,您可以联系服务器提供商或管理员咨询相关信息。
相关问题
服务器上查看gpu,cpu等使用情况
在服务器上查看GPU、CPU等硬件资源的使用情况通常涉及监控系统工具。对于Linux服务器,你可以使用以下几种命令:
1. **top**: 这是最常用的实时系统监控工具,按百分比显示CPU负载,并列出了进程、内存、交换分区以及每个CPU核心的使用情况。按'q'退出。
```bash
top -u [username]
```
如果你想查看GPU信息,很多情况下需要特定的第三方软件如`nvidia-smi` (针对NVIDIA GPU) 或 `aticonfig` (AMD GPU)。
2. **htop**: 是一个更直观的动态树状视图版本的top,对内存使用也更有帮助。
3. **nvidia-smi** (NVIDIA): 可以提供详细的NVIDIA GPU状态、温度、功耗等信息。
4. **glances**: 如果安装了这个跨平台的图形化监控工具,可以同时查看CPU、内存、硬盘和GPU等多种资源。
5. **lm_sensors**: 用于检测传感器数据,包括CPU温度、风扇速度等,但对于GPU监控,一般需要额外的驱动支持。
6. **Perfmon或Windows的任务管理器**: 对于Windows服务器,任务管理器提供了类似的功能,可以查看CPU、GPU和其他硬件资源的使用情况。
记得根据你的服务器操作系统和具体的硬件配置选择合适的工具。如果服务器有远程访问权限,还可以通过web界面或者远程桌面软件进行查看。
bert使用cpu服务器和GPU服务器有什么区别
BERT 可以在 CPU 和 GPU 上运行,但是在 GPU 上运行会比在 CPU 上快很多。这是因为 GPU 拥有更多的处理核心和更高的内存带宽,能够并行处理更多的计算任务。
在使用 CPU 服务器时,BERT 的计算速度会比较慢,但是可以满足一些简单的语言模型任务。而在使用 GPU 服务器时,BERT 的计算速度会非常快,可以处理大规模的自然语言处理任务,如机器翻译、文本分类、问答系统等。
此外,GPU 服务器通常需要更多的电力和冷却,成本也更高。因此,在选择使用 CPU 或 GPU 服务器时,需要根据具体的需求和预算进行权衡和选择。
阅读全文